Picked up a Star Firestar .45 auto at the local gun shop a couple of months back. I have had a .40 S&W Firestar for some time and really like it. Both guns shoot great, but of the two, I prefer to carry the .40 as the .45 isnt really THAT much smaller than a commander size 1911 and is pretty thick to boot. The .45 Firestar came with three mags (gun and all mags are the Starvel finish) and was as new in the box for $225.00. The barrel is slightly shorter than commander size, and the frame is about OM size.

If $280 is your true max for a handgun, think revolver rather than automatic.

It's hard enough to get a reliable auto pistol, much tougher in this price range.

However, you can get a good .357 revolver in this price range if you shop around.  

Revolvers don't get "style points" among some people, but you can bet your life on one!
